Output 39a52ccc76f5edfac0185c210d29fc819bdc2b96f6f62960d6a4fbde21728a6a:3

value
1054258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f4b29d4cf6b22457afe39e497ea1025867c3a34 OP_EQUAL
address
3Lb5qhQaLhg6884fiCLswev9jXSw91LSgd
transaction
39a52ccc76f5edfac0185c210d29fc819bdc2b96f6f62960d6a4fbde21728a6a
spent
true